2015 Pro Kabaddi League

The 2015 Pro Kabaddi League was the third season of India’s premier professional kabaddi league, showcasing the sport's growing popularity and professionalization. Organized by Mashal Sports and sanctioned by the Amateur Kabaddi Federation of India, the season featured eight teams representing various regions of the country. The tournament commenced on January 9, 2016, and concluded on February 7, 2016, with matches held across multiple venues in India. The season adopted a new format, including a round-robin league followed by playoff matches. Patna Pirates emerged as champions, defeating U Mumba in the final. The league significantly contributed to the resurgence of kabaddi, attracting substantial viewership and sponsorship, thereby promoting the sport on a national scale.
